CC   -!- FUNCTION: Component of the coat protein complex II (COPII) which
CC       promotes the formation of transport vesicles from the endoplasmic
CC       reticulum (ER). The coat has two main functions, the physical
CC       deformation of the endoplasmic reticulum membrane into vesicles and the
CC       selection of cargo molecules. It also functions as a component of the
CC       nuclear pore complex (NPC). NPC components, collectively referred to as
CC       nucleoporins (NUPs), can play the role of both NPC structural
CC       components and of docking or interaction partners for transiently
CC       associated nuclear transport factors. SEC13 is required for efficient
CC       mRNA export from the nucleus to the cytoplasm and for correct nuclear
CC       pore biogenesis and distribution. {ECO:0000256|ARBA:ARBA00025261}.
CC   -!- SUBUNIT: The COPII coat is composed of at least 5 proteins: the
CC       SEC23/24 complex, the SEC13/31 complex, and the protein SAR1. Component
CC       of the nuclear pore complex (NPC). NPC constitutes the exclusive means
CC       of nucleocytoplasmic transport. NPCs allow the passive diffusion of
CC       ions and small molecules and the active, nuclear transport receptor-
CC       mediated bidirectional transport of macromolecules such as proteins,
CC       RNAs, ribonucleoparticles (RNPs), and ribosomal subunits across the
CC       nuclear envelope. Due to its 8-fold rotational symmetry, all subunits
CC       are present with 8 copies or multiples thereof.
CC       {ECO:0000256|ARBA:ARBA00011369}.
CC   -!- SUBCELLULAR LOCATION: Nucleus, nuclear pore complex
CC       {ECO:0000256|ARBA:ARBA00004567}.
CC   -!- SIMILARITY: Belongs to the WD repeat SEC13 family.
CC       {ECO:0000256|ARBA:ARBA00010102}.
